This former coal spoil batch can be found in the Cam Valley - an area rich in the remains of the former somersetshire coal mining industry. As well as being a Local Nature Reserve the site is also important for geology and is designated as a Regionally Important Geological Site (RIGS).
The site is now a woodland owned and managed by Camerton Parish Council. It has steeply wooded slopes and supports a good variety of fungi. There is a heritage and nature trail.
Access can be gained from Red Hill, Camerton, Near Timsbury. Look out for the Miner!!
